Pipeline Framework: Early Years Covid Recovery Childminder Mentor Programme
A pipeline has been launched for Early Years Covid Recovery Childminder Mentor Programme.The contract start Date is 17 November 2022. Approach to market date is 14 September 2022.**THIS PIN NOTICE IS TO NOTIFY SUPPLIERS OF A POTENTIAL UPCOMING REQUIREMENT THAT WILL BE ADVERTISED THROUGH THE DEPARTMENT FOR EDUCATION – EDUCATION AND CHILDREN'S SOCIAL CARE DYNAMIC PURCHASING SYSTEM (ECSC DPS)****THIS IS NOT A CALL FOR COMPETITION**Evidence tells us that the quality of education and care in early years has the biggest impact on children’s outcomes within a childcare setting. As such, we have designed a programme for early years focused on supporting practitioners, who are key to supporting the youngest children.The Department for Education is looking for a delivery partner to support with a new strand of the existing Early Years Experts and Mentors programme, exclusively for childminders. More information on the current programme is available here.The childminder programme will be a peer-to-peer support programme, requiring current childminders to apply for the role of Mentor, to support other childminders. The Department for Education will also be looking a number of candidates to fulfil the role of Area Lead, which involves providing support to Mentors in their locality. Support provided by this programme will be predominately virtual.The Department for Education requires a delivery partner to oversee the logistical aspects of this programme. The successful bidder will utilize their expertise and understanding of the early years sector to fulfil a number of activities. This will include but is not limited to managing the recruitment process of candidates to act as Mentors and Area Leads, including assessing applications and completing video interviews, organising the matching of candidates to childminders in need of support, and collecting feedback and management information from various parties on a regular basis throughout the programme. The role will also involve contact and communications with local authorities and the Department for Education Stronger Practice Hubs.The Department for Education intends to undertake a procurement exercise to appoint a suitably experienced organisation, or individual(s), to provide programme support for the Early Years Experts and Mentors Childminder programme.The Department for Education will be holding a market engagement event on 1st September 2022 14:00 – 15:00.
